#!/bin/bash
#
# adjust_ice.sh
#
# This script takes a csv data file with downlink, uplink and rtt values
# and uses the values to adjust an existing running wanlink.
#
# Each value is checked against the committed information rate (CIR) limits
# and when the limit is exceeded a shuffled value is chosen between a default
# min and max.
#
# Inputs are:
# csv filename
# name of wanlink
# run time between value changes
cd /home/lanforge/scripts
file=$1
name=$2
run_time=$3
print_help() {
echo "Usage: $0 {csv filename} {wanlink name} {run time}"
echo " Use this on lanforge localhost"
echo " Run time units are seconds"
echo " $0 values.csv wanlink-01 60"
echo ""
}
if [ $# -eq 0 ]; then
print_help
exit 1
fi
slices=10
cir_dn=3500000
cir_up=2000000
min=20000
max=200000
dates=()
downlink=()
uplink=()
delay=()
declare -A months
months=([Jan]=1 [Feb]=2 [Mar]=3 [Apr]=4 [May]=5 [Jun]=6 [Jul]=7 [Aug]=8 [Sep]=9 [Oct]=10 [Nov]=11 [Dec]=12)
# expects a "d-m-y hours:minutes meridian" format
function date_to_ts() {
local year
local hourmin
local meridian
[ -z "$1" ] && echo "date_to_ts: wants \$1 date string" && exit 1
local hunks=($1);
local datehunks=()
IFS=- read -r -a datehunks < <(echo "${hunks[0]}")
local month=${datehunks[1]}
local monthno=${months[$month]}
#echo "${monthno}/${datehunks[0]}/${datehunks[2]} ${hunks[1]} ${hunks[2]}"
date --date "${monthno}/${datehunks[0]}/${datehunks[2]} ${hunks[1]} ${hunks[2]}" +"%s"
}
function get_values() {
while read -r line
do
if [[ $line != "" ]]; then
if [[ $line == *DATE* ]]; then
continue;
fi
if [[ $line != *-* ]]; then
continue;
fi
local datestr=`echo $line |cut -d '"' -f1 |sed 's/,/ /g'`
local timest=$(date_to_ts "$datestr")
dates+=($timest)
local dl=`echo $line |cut -d '"' -f2 |sed 's/,//g'`
if [[ $dl < $cir_dn ]]; then
let dl=$(( $cir_dn - $dl ))
downlink+=( $dl )
else
let bas=$(shuf -i "$min-$max" -n1)
downlink+=( $bas )
fi
local ul=`echo $line |cut -d '"' -f6 |sed 's/,//g'`
if [[ $ul < $cir_up ]]; then
let ul=$(( $cir_up - $ul ))
uplink+=( $ul )
else
let bas=$(shuf -i "$min-$max" -n1)
uplink+=( $bas )
fi
local lat=`echo $line |cut -d '"' -f9 |sed 's/,//g' |cut -d '.' -f1`
let lat=$(( $lat/2 ))
delay+=( $lat )
fi
done < $file
}
function modify_values {
[ -z "$1" ] && echo "modify_values wants row index \$1, bye" && exit 1
local row_idx=$1
local dl_now=0
local ul_now=0
local lt_now=0
local ts_now=${dates[$row_idx]}
local ts_next=${dates[ $(( $row_idx +1 )) ]}
local delta=$(( $ts_next - $ts_now ))
local pause=$(( $delta / $slices ))
#echo "now: $ts_now, next: $ts_next, delta: $delta pause: $pause"
local downlink_now="${downlink[$row_idx]}"
local downlink_next="${downlink[ $(( $row_idx +1 )) ]}"
local downlink_delta=$(( $downlink_next - $downlink_now ))
local uplink_now="${uplink[$row_idx]}"
local uplink_next="${uplink[ $(( $row_idx +1 )) ]}"
local uplink_delta=$(( $uplink_next - $uplink_now ))
local delay_now="${delay[ $row_idx ]}"
local delay_next="${delay[ $(( $row_idx +1 )) ]}"
local delay_delta=$(( $delay_next - $delay_now ))
local dl_series=()
local ul_series=()
local delay_series=()
local j;
#echo "Deltas: $downlink_delta $uplink_delta $delay_delta"
echo "Now: $downlink_now $uplink_now $delay_now"
for ((j=1; j < $slices; ++j)); do
local d_j=$(( $downlink_delta / $slices ))
local u_j=$(( $uplink_delta / $slices ))
local l_j=$(( $delay_delta / $slices ))
local d_a=$d_j
local u_a=$u_j
if [[ $l_j != 0 ]]; then
local l_a=$l_j
else
local l_a=1
fi
[[ $d_j -lt 0 ]] && d_a=$(( -1 * $d_j ))
[[ $u_j -lt 0 ]] && u_a=$(( -1 * $u_j ))
[[ $l_j -lt 0 ]] && l_a=$(( -1 * $l_j ))
local d_i=$(( ($j * $d_j) + `shuf -i 1-$d_a -n1` ))
local u_i=$(( ($j * $u_j) + `shuf -i 1-$u_a -n1` ))
local l_i=$(( ($j * $l_j) + `shuf -i 1-$l_a -n1` ))
#echo "$j: $d_i $u_i $l_i"
echo "$j: $(($downlink_now + $d_i)) $(($uplink_now + $u_i)) $(($delay_now + $l_i))"
dl_series+=( $(($downlink_now + $d_i)) )
ul_series+=( $(($uplink_now + $u_i)) )
delay_series+=( $(($delay_now + $l_i)) )
done
echo "Next: $downlink_next $uplink_next $delay_next"
for ((j=0; j < 9; ++j)); do
dl_now=${dl_series[$j]}
ul_now=${ul_series[$j]}
lt_now=${delay_series[$j]}
echo "set wanlink $name: $dl_now $ul_now $lt_now"
echo "set wanlink $name-A: Downlink $dl_now, Delay $lt_now"
./lf_firemod.pl --mgr localhost --quiet on --action do_cmd --cmd \
"set_wanlink_info $name-A $dl_now $lt_now NA NA NA NA" &>/dev/null
echo "set wanlink $name-B: Uplink $ul_now, Delay $lt_now"
./lf_firemod.pl --mgr localhost --quiet on --action do_cmd --cmd \
"set_wanlink_info $name-B $ul_now $lt_now NA NA NA NA" &>/dev/null
echo "B-LOOP Waiting for $pause seconds."
sleep $pause
done
}
get_values
stop_at="$(( ${#downlink[@]} - 1 ))"
for ((i=0; i < $stop_at; ++i)); do
#echo "set wanlink $name: ${downlink[i]} ${uplink[i]} ${delay[i]}"
echo "set wanlink $name-A: Downlink ${downlink[i]}, Delay ${delay[i]}"
./lf_firemod.pl --mgr localhost --quiet on --action do_cmd --cmd \
"set_wanlink_info $name-A ${downlink[i]} ${delay[i]} NA NA NA NA" &>/dev/null
echo "set wanlink $name-B: Uplink ${uplink[i]}, Delay ${delay[i]}"
./lf_firemod.pl --mgr localhost --quiet on --action do_cmd --cmd \
"set_wanlink_info $name-B ${uplink[i]} ${delay[i]} NA NA NA NA" &>/dev/null
echo "A-LOOP Waiting for $run_time seconds."
sleep $run_time
[[ $i -ge $stop_at ]] && break
modify_values $i
done
